Frank Saverio: to me, crime fiction and science fiction are actually more closely related than some other genres because both of them really provide you the opportunity to tell a story on the surface that, you know, has some complexity and action and nuance of character and And can be enjoyed just for what it is, but you can also, uh, examine, you know, things under the surface a little bit, a little, little social examination or social commentary or explore the human condition a little bit on a deeper level.
And any book will let you do that. Uh, certainly crime fiction and science fiction don't, don't have the market cornered, but the difference between the two, and it's, and it's especially true with science fiction, I think, is that. You kind of can come under the reader's defenses a little bit, like especially with science fiction, because, um, you know, they're, ah, that's a made up story on a made up planet, you know, and so they just accept it.
And so they're not like resistive to the exploration of a couple of ideas, uh, that you might [00:01:00] get into about, you know, whatever social condition or human condition you want to explore.
